6. The tax effect of interest payments on loans to make real estate investments Aa Aa Alex invested in residential real estate for $250,000 ($212,500 for the building and $37,500 for the land). He financed his purchase with a 20-year mortgage for $125,000 at an interest rate of 5%. A year has passed since his purchase. Alex is now curious about how his taxes, cash flow, after-tax return, and after-tax yield would have been different if he had paid cash for the property. Alex's files indicate the following information regarding his investment: Rental revenues were $37,500 The depreciation deduction was $7,727 Alex paid $6,165 interest on the mortgage Alex is in a 25% tax bracket Complete the following table. Assume that all factors except those described above remain constant. For the after-tax yields, round your answers to the nearest decimal and round all other answers to the nearest whole number. Enter all figures as positive numbers, and follow the guidance in the tables to perform the appropriate mathematical operations.
